iOS开发者必备:MySQL事务与日志实战
|
作为主机运维者,我经常需要与各种系统打交道,其中iOS开发者的环境配置和数据库管理是不可忽视的一部分。MySQL事务与日志机制在iOS应用的数据处理中扮演着关键角色。 事务是确保数据一致性的核心概念。在iOS开发中,当多个操作需要同时成功或失败时,事务可以防止部分更新导致的数据不一致问题。比如用户注册流程涉及多张表的写入,使用事务能保证整个过程的原子性。 MySQL的日志系统包括二进制日志、重做日志和回滚日志。这些日志不仅用于数据恢复,还能帮助开发者分析应用行为。在调试或排查生产环境问题时,查看日志能够快速定位错误源头。 对于iOS开发者来说,理解事务的ACID特性(原子性、一致性、隔离性、持久性)至关重要。尤其是在高并发场景下,合理设置事务隔离级别可以避免脏读、不可重复读等问题。 在实际部署中,建议为MySQL配置合适的日志格式和存储路径。例如,启用binlog并设置为ROW模式,可以更精确地记录数据变更,便于后续审计或数据同步。
AI绘图结果,仅供参考 定期备份事务日志和数据库是保障数据安全的基础措施。即使发生意外宕机,也能通过日志恢复到最近的稳定状态,减少业务损失。 掌握MySQL事务与日志的原理和实践,不仅能提升iOS应用的数据可靠性,还能帮助开发者更好地与运维团队协作,共同保障系统的稳定性。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

